This is a classic recipe of herb roasted potatoes as a side dish to your main course or if you add more root vegetables it can even be a simple meal on its own.

Indregients:
- Potatoes (cut into wedges if they are the normal baking potato)
- Olive Oil
- Rosemary
- Basil
- Oregano
- Salt
- Pepper
(root vegetables may be added to your preference)
Instructions:
- Preheat oven
- Mix all the ingredients together, add salt and pepper to taste
- Wrap everything (except vegetables) in aluminium foil
- Bake for 40 minutes
- Unwrap the aluminium foil and add the remaining vegetables, then without wrapping it, put it back to the oven and bake for another 20 minutes
- If no vegetables are used, then just unwrap the aluminium foil and bake it for another 20 minutes so the potato skin will be crispy
